FAQ
- What is Ball Corporation's return on invested capital?
- Ball Corporation (BALL) reported return on invested capital of 9.4% in Q1 2026.
- How has Ball Corporation's return on invested capital changed year-over-year?
- Ball Corporation's return on invested capital increased by 55.1% year-over-year, from 6.1% to 9.4%.
- What is the long-term trend for Ball Corporation's return on invested capital?
-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Ball Corporation's return on invested capital has grown at a 2.9%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from 8.9% to 10.3%.
- What does return on invested capital mean?
- Net operating profit after tax (operating income taxed at the effective rate) divided by average invested capital (debt plus equity minus cash). Measures the after-tax return on all capital put to work in the business, independent of capital structure.
